Why some monkeys don't get AIDS

Saturday, December 5, 2009 - 12:28 in Biology & Nature

Two new studies provide a significant advance in understanding how some species of monkeys such as sooty mangabeys and African green monkeys avoid AIDS when infected with SIV, the simian equivalent of HIV.
